Output 65f99c941199cee3ea571305ac319ec636f72d605a87cad04594282dd79c143e:1

value
2143800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a0dfdcec414948cfdf4e7f6374e9981c4e46b08 OP_EQUAL
address
3FjakEA99JHjY5eatTRDLwYJBRYvVZkutg
transaction
65f99c941199cee3ea571305ac319ec636f72d605a87cad04594282dd79c143e
confirmations
337581
spent
true